On your user dashboard, there's a "Configure Fax" button near the top center. You'll need to do that so that TP can send your request. But you can (and should!) also go to https://touringplans.com/hotel_maps to check out the view from every room on property. It's amazing! When you find one you like, you can click a button to automatically edit your room request for that room.How do you make room requests?
